Introduction to the Pumpkin Spice Latte
The Pumpkin Spice Latte was first introduced by Starbucks in 2003 and has since become a staple of the fall season. The drink is made with espresso, steamed milk, and a blend of pumpkin pie spices, topped with whipped cream and pumpkin pie spice. Over the years, the PSL has gained a cult following, with fans eagerly anticipating its release each year. The exact release date of the PSL may vary from year to year, but it is typically available from late August to early January.

What ingredients are used to make a Pumpkin Spice Latte?
A Pumpkin Spice Latte from Starbucks is made with a combination of espresso, steamed milk, and a flavor syrup that gives the drink its distinctive taste and aroma. The syrup is made with a blend of ingredients, including pumpkin puree, cinnamon, nutmeg, and cloves, which are combined with sugar and other natural flavorings. The drink is topped with a layer of whipped cream and a sprinkle of pumpkin pie spice, adding to its festive and seasonal appeal.

How many calories are in a Pumpkin Spice Latte?
The calorie count for a Pumpkin Spice Latte from Starbucks can vary depending on the size and type of milk used, as well as any modifications or toppings. A grande PSL made with 2% milk and topped with whipped cream contains approximately 380 calories. However, this number can increase significantly if you opt for a larger size, use a non-dairy milk alternative, or add extra pumps of syrup or whipped cream.
To put this in perspective, a grande PSL made with non-fat milk and no whipped cream contains around 260 calories, while a venti PSL made with whole milk and whipped cream can contain over 550 calories. How much does a Pumpkin Spice Latte cost?
The cost of a Pumpkin Spice Latte from Starbucks can vary depending on the location, size, and type of milk used. On average, a grande PSL made with 2% milk and topped with whipped cream can cost around $5 to $6. However, prices may be higher or lower in different regions, and you can also expect to pay more for larger sizes or specialty modifications.
To give you a better idea, here are some approximate price ranges for a PSL at Starbucks: a short PSL (8 oz) can cost around $4 to $5, a tall PSL (12 oz) can cost around $4.50 to $5.50, and a venti PSL (20 oz) can cost around $6 to $7.
